Well actually when I promoted from II.3 I relegated right away just like everyone else. I would claim the difference was that I had a rock solid plan (and a lot of luck) to relegate right away making a ton of money that would set me up for seasons to come. So in season 17 I won II.3, season 18 tanked like crazy and made a fortune. Season 19 I won division II.4. Then I have made the playoffs in the ABBL for the last seven seasons in a row never finishing below fourth and even having the second best regular season record a couple of times. This is not even close to what Whitebeard has achieved and my only silverware has been a MVP for Lawrance but seven seasons in a row in the ABBL playoffs is far from a disaster.
